What happens when you apply every available Instagram filter to one photo?

The photo on the left is how it was taken with Instagram, the one on the right is what happens when you apply a filter to it, re-upload, apply a new filter, and so on.

In other words, the photo on the right is Normal + Amaro + Rise + Hudson + Sierra + X-Pro + Lo-Fi + Earlybird + Sutro + Toaster + Brannan + Inkwell + Walden + Hefe + Valencia + Nashville + 1977 + Kelvin (that’s 17 filter effects).
